The Doors – L.A. Woman

Label:

Rhino Records (2) – RHF1 75011, Rhino Records (2) – 603497822416, Elektra – RHF1 75011, Elektra – 603497822416, Doors Music Company LLC – RHF1 75011, Doors Music Company LLC – 603497822416

Series:

Rhino High Fidelity

Format:

Vinyl, LP, Album, Limited Edition, Reissue, Stereo, 180g, Gatefold

Country:

US

Released:

Genre:

Rock

Style:

Blues Rock
A1 The Changeling 4:21
A2 Love Her Madly 3:20
A3 Been Down So Long 4:41
A4 Cars Hiss By My Window 4:11
A5 L.A. Woman 7:49
B1 L'America 4:37
B2 Hyacinth House 3:11
B3 Crawling King Snake 5:00
B4 The WASP (Texas Radio And The Big Beat) 4:13
B5 Riders On The Storm 7:14
  • Phonographic Copyright ℗ – Elektra Records
  • Copyright © – Elektra Records
  • Record Company – Warner Music Group
  • Manufactured For – Rhino Entertainment Company
  • Marketed By – Rhino Entertainment Company
  • Recorded At – The Doors Workshop
  • Lacquer Cut At – Cohearent Audio
  • Pressed By – Optimal Media GmbH – BO17953
  • Art Direction [Rhino Hi-Fi], Design [Rhino Hi-Fi] – Rachel Gutek
  • Bass – Jerry Scheff
  • Design Concept [Album] – Carl Cossick
  • Design [Inner Gatefold], Photography By [Insert Photos] – Frank Lisciandro
  • Drums – John Densmore
  • Guitar – Robby Krieger
  • Lacquer Cut By – KPG*
  • Logo [Rhino Hi-Fi] – Lisa Glines
  • Management [Worldwide Management] – Jeffrey Jampol, Kenny Nemes
  • Mastered By – Kevin Gray
  • Piano, Organ – Ray Manzarek
  • Producer – Bruce Botnick, The Doors
  • Project Manager [Project Supervision] – Patrick Milligan
  • Research [The Doors Archivist] – David Dutkowski
  • Rhythm Guitar – Marc Benno (tracks: A3, A4, A5, B3)
  • Supervised By [Production Supervisor] – Jac Holzman
  • Vocals – Jim Morrison
  • Written-By – The Doors
Unnumbered individual release of L.A. Woman, using the same cut/version as in The Doors - The Doors: 1967-1971.

The OBI reads:

- 180-Gram Vinyl
- Cut From Original Analog Master Tapes by Kevin Gray at Cohearent Audio
- Pressed At On Optimal Media
- Heavyweight Gatefold Jacket
- Includes Exclusive Insert with Recollections From Band Members and Studio Personnel Compiled by Doors Archivist David Dutkowski
- Limited Edition
